Does linking ESG performance to executive pay actually make a difference?

Linking executive pay to environmental performance is an increasingly common ask from sustainable investors, but does it help deliver real world results?

If Sweden's Cevian Capital has its way, this coming proxy season European shareholders will be voting on a lot more compensation plans that tie a portion of executive pay to whether companies hit various...
